Can USDT and USDC always be treated as one dollar?

Understand conversion error in stablecoin-quoted price comparisons.

Smart Coin editorialUpdated 2026-08-18About 6min

A dollar and a stablecoin are different assets

Issuance, redemption access and market demand differ.

Local venue premiums can appear

Fiat rails, regulation and liquidity affect the price.

Inspect the normalization route

A comparison needs the timestamp and source of USDT/USD or USDC/USD.
